8x8 UCaaS & Communications Review
8x8, Inc. is a cloud communications company headquartered in Campbell, California, delivering unified communications (UCaaS), contact centre (CCaaS), and communications platform (CPaaS) services through its integrated XCaaS (eXperience Communications as a Service) platform. Founded in 1987 and listed on Nasdaq (EGHT), 8x8 operates a cloud-native architecture that combines voice, video, messaging, and contact centre capabilities within a single platform, supported by a financially backed 99.999% uptime SLA. The company serves businesses across more than 50 countries and has been recognised in the Gartner Magic Quadrant for UCaaS for fourteen consecutive years.

What Netify Thinks
8x8 is a mature, enterprise-grade cloud communications platform. Its principal strength is the integration of UCaaS, CCaaS, and CPaaS capabilities into a single platform — avoiding the operational complexity of managing separate vendors for internal communications, customer-facing contact centre, and developer-facing APIs.
Strengths
- Integrated XCaaS platform: UCaaS, CCaaS, and CPaaS converged in a single system eliminates the fragmentation of managing separate communication stacks, reducing vendor management overhead and providing a unified data lake for reporting and AI analytics.
- 14 consecutive years in Gartner UCaaS MQ: Reflects consistent platform delivery and market credibility across the full history of the cloud communications market.
- Microsoft Teams integration: Native integration options including Contact Center for Teams, Voice for Teams via Direct Routing as a Service, and Operator Connect address the dominant enterprise collaboration platform without requiring full Teams Phone licensing.
- 99.999% uptime SLA: Financially backed platform-wide SLA across both UCaaS and CCaaS — a commitment not universally offered across the market.
Weaknesses
- Not an SD-WAN or SASE vendor: 8x8 has no networking, SD-WAN, or security service edge products. Its inclusion on the Netify marketplace reflects its role as a communications overlay relevant to enterprises also evaluating SD-WAN and SASE architecture, but direct comparison with SD-WAN vendors is not applicable.
- Competitive UCaaS market: 8x8 competes directly with RingCentral, Cisco Webex, Microsoft Teams Phone, and Zoom Phone — all of which have larger installed bases or deeper ecosystem integrations in specific enterprise segments.
- Pricing perception: Independent reviews note that 8x8's pricing can be less flexible than some competitors for smaller deployments, and that the modular approach requires careful licence planning to avoid unexpected costs.
